Quote:
Originally Posted by EldrickOnIce View Post
So would we have been happy(ier) with this kind of bridge for Gaudreau?
Think the difference is Tampa's winning the cup window and Calgary's

Tampa's window is now and within those 3 years which makes this deal very attractive for the team

Calgary's window is further out so securing Johnny for longer helps to hopefully ensure the teams winning window opens well Johnny is still around

So for Calgary's situation definitely prefer the 6 year term vs. the 3 year term based on the current state of the team especially compared to a team like Tampa who has had some recent success
